Core Gameplay Loop and Betting Mechanics
The fundamental structure of Miner Donkey Rider Crashback aligns with the established principles of crash gaming. Each round commences after a betting window, during which players select their desired stake. The interface provides straightforward ‘+' and ‘-‘ buttons flanking the main bet amount display, allowing for granular adjustment of the wager size before the round initiates. Crucially, bets must be finalized before the mine cart begins its journey. A short countdown timer is typically visible, indicating the remaining time to place or adjust wagers.
Once the betting phase concludes, the round starts. The mine cart, carrying the miner and donkey duo, starts moving along the tracks depicted on screen. Simultaneously, a multiplier figure, beginning at 1.00x, starts to climb. The rate of increase can vary, contributing to the game's unpredictable nature. The primary objective for the player is to manually activate the ‘CASH OUT' button before the round randomly terminates in a ‘crash'. Successfully timing the cashout secures a win equal to the placed bet multiplied by the exact multiplier value displayed at the moment the button is pressed. For instance, cashing out at a 5.25x multiplier on a $1.00 bet results in a $5.25 return.
The tension inherent in this genre stems directly from the conflict between securing a modest multiplier early and holding out for potentially much larger gains, all while knowing the round could end instantaneously without warning. If the crash occurs before the player cashes out, the entire stake for that round is forfeited. This core risk-reward dynamic is the engine driving the gameplay. The game explicitly states a maximum multiplier cap of 5000x the total bet. Should the multiplier miraculously reach this ceiling during a round, any active bets are automatically cashed out at this peak value, representing the game's ultimate potential return on a single wager. It's also vital to understand that the game clarifies that “Each round is randomly generated from a pre-determined list of mathematical outcomes,” reinforcing that visual progress does not influence the predetermined crash point.
The Distinguishing Crashback Feature
The defining element that attempts to differentiate Miner Donkey Rider Crashback is its eponymous Crashback mechanic. This system provides a conditional opportunity for players who have already cashed out of a round to potentially re-engage with that same ongoing round. The premise is straightforward: if a player executes a cashout, perhaps at a relatively low multiplier like 2.5x, but observes the mine cart continuing its journey and the multiplier climbing significantly higher (e.g., reaching 10x or more), the Crashback feature may become available for a limited time.
Activation of Crashback is not automatic and requires player intervention within a specific, albeit brief, timeframe after their initial cashout. If a player decides to utilize this feature, it comes at a cost. The game rules specify this cost as “the difference between the previous cashout and the current multiplier.” This phrasing suggests the cost is deducted from the player's balance, representing the additional risk capital required to re-enter at the higher, ongoing multiplier level. For example, if a player cashed out $2.50 (1.00 bet at 2.5x) and the multiplier is now 10x, re-entering via Crashback might require an additional input reflecting the potential gain difference (in this conceptual example, related to the 7.5x increase), allowing them to then ride the multiplier further from the 10x point. The exact cost calculation method is a critical detail. Automation and Control Options
Miner Donkey Rider Crashback incorporates standard automation features designed to facilitate extended play sessions or execute pre-defined strategies. The AUTO PLAY function enables players to set a specific number of consecutive rounds for which the game will automatically place the currently selected bet amount. This allows for hands-off participation over multiple rounds. Importantly, the game rules clarify that bets placed via Auto Play for upcoming rounds can generally be cancelled before the next round begins, offering a degree of flexibility. Furthermore, Auto Play is designed to be automatically cancelled if the Crashback feature is triggered, preventing unintended automatic re-entries.
Complementing Auto Play is the AUTO CASH OUT feature. This allows players to pre-set a specific multiplier value at which the game should automatically attempt to cash out their bet. For instance, a player could set an Auto Cash Out target of 3.00x. If the round multiplier reaches or exceeds this value, the system will execute the cashout command. Holding the ‘+' or ‘-‘ buttons associated with this feature allows for quicker adjustment to higher or lower target values. However, the game explicitly and correctly warns that “AUTO CASH OUT does not guarantee a win!” This is a critical disclaimer. If the game crashes before the multiplier reaches the pre-set Auto Cash Out target, the bet is still lost. Therefore, Auto Cash Out serves as a tool for disciplined profit-taking at a desired level, but it cannot circumvent the fundamental risk of the crash occurring early. These tools are useful for players employing consistent strategies or those who prefer automated execution, but they require careful configuration and an understanding of their inherent limitations.
